Verdict

The Fischer Audio FA-006 is a pair of closed-back circumaural headphones featuring 40mm dynamic drivers that deliver a frequency response of 20 Hz to 20,000 Hz. Designed for efficient power handling with a 36-ohm impedance and a sensitivity of 105 dB/mW, these headphones are known for their high sound pressure level and a generous 3-metre cable that provides ample movement. Their main pros include being easy to drive with portable devices and including a travel bag for added portability. However, they lack active noise cancellation and passive noise reduction, which may lead to higher ear fatigue and background noise interference compared to competing models.

What customers like about Fischer Audio Fa 006?

  • Excellent price-to-performance value, often cited as a top recommendation for under $100
  • High fidelity sound quality with smooth treble and accurate midrange
  • Holographic soundstage with good depth and width for an entry-level set
  • Can be driven easily without an external amplifier (36 Ohm impedance)
  • Includes a variety of accessories such as a travel bag, 1/4" adapter, and extra velour pads
  • Features a detachable and easily replaceable cable for increased durability
  • Lightweight and portable design suitable for commuting

What customers dislike about Fischer Audio Fa 006?

  • Out-of-the-box fit can be less comfortable than other models like the FA-003 or FA-011
  • Improper fit leads to sound leakage and a significant loss in deep bass response
  • Ear cups are relatively shallow, which may cause the interior to touch the user's ears
  • Bass reproduction lacks the 'force of presence' desired by bassheads, missing the lowest sub-bass frequencies
  • Standard cloth/leatherette pads can be more difficult to clean than simple wipe-down materials
  • Lacks modern features like a built-in microphone, in-line controls, or active noise cancellation
